摘要: 在DDD.Domain工程文件夹Repository下创建RequestPage类: 在 Repository文件夹IRepository接口中定义: 在DDD.Repository工程ResultPage类中:(结果集) 在EFRepository中实现分页的方法: 在DDD.Infrastruc 阅读全文
posted @ 2017-11-18 22:11 石shi 阅读(1426) 评论(0) 推荐(0) 编辑
摘要: 思路: 1、用Ado.NET获取数据 2、控制器中创建一个方法参数为搜索条件 3、返回前台一个Json对象,把对象用一个类封装 4、用JQuery接收数据 Ado取数据: JQuery时间戳的处理: 分页和接收数据拼接URL地址: 阅读全文
posted @ 2017-11-18 20:52 石shi 阅读(509) 评论(0) 推荐(0) 编辑
摘要: DTO的应用场景: 定义产品类: NueGet 添加AutoMapper映射组件。 定义ProductDTO对象: 定义两个类: 多个对象的映射类: 映射的代码: 在上下文接口中(IRepositoryContext)中定义DTO的支持: 仓储接口的调整: 上下文DTO定义:(让EF上下文实现) E 阅读全文
posted @ 2017-11-18 20:33 石shi 阅读(510) 评论(0) 推荐(0) 编辑
摘要: 添加下订单的值对象: 产品值对象: 订单项的实体: 销售订单的聚合根: 跨聚合的事务处理一般通过领域服务来做。(DomainService)主要是协调的作用 添加界面和核心业务层保护的作用:(DDD.Application) 添加引用: 添加基础服务实现的机制:(DDD.Infrastructure 阅读全文
posted @ 2017-11-18 17:27 石shi 阅读(860) 评论(0) 推荐(1) 编辑